Largo Weather in September
Largo in September averages 31°C (88°F) during the day and 24°C (75°F) at night. September is part of the rainy season, so frequent rainfall is typical.
Rainfall in Largo in September
As part of the rainy season, Largo sees around 16 days of rain in September, with an average of 206 mm (8.1 in). The rainy season here brings regular, substantial showers. It's worth being prepared for rain on most days you're out.
Temperature in Largo in September
In September, Largo sees very high temperatures, with highs of 31°C (88°F). Nights drop to around 24°C (75°F). The hottest part of the day is usually in the afternoon, so lighter clothing can help you stay comfortable. At 24°C (75°F) overnight, it stays warm after dark. Light, breathable clothing and good airflow in your room make a noticeable difference.
Sunshine in Largo in September
There are approximately 241 hours of sunshine this month, despite being the rainy season. Rain often arrives in the late afternoon or evening, keeping mornings and early afternoons sunny.
